Seriously - a friend of mine used to do this with a massive bass cabinet. It was dead easy to roll along on the board.
If that sounds too weird - and to be fair, the small wheels aren't ideal on anything other than a smooth surface - then just search on Amazon for a folding sack trolley. The weight rating doesn't have to be too big - the MkI probably 'only' weighs about 40Kg.
